Tottenham Hotspur interested in Victor Moses
Tottenham Hotspur will look to secure the services of forward Victor Moses from Chelsea before the transfer window closes.
The Nigerian international had a good spell with Stoke City on loan last term, and this led to the speculation that he could seek a permanent switch to the Britannia Stadium.
However, the Potters failed to agree on a permanent move for the talented winger, and opted to sign up recruits elsewhere.
According to The Telegraph, Spurs are one among the top sides vying for Moses' signature this summer.
Moses joined the Premier League champions from Wigan Athletic in 2012.
